Public Health Announcement

September 12, 2022

On September 10, 2022 the Board of Health received results of a water quality sample collected on September 7, 2022 at the Town Beach. The results indicate no harmful levels of cyanobacteria (blue-green algae).  

At this time, all Normal activities are permitted, because:

-Cyanobacteria levels are < 70,000 cells/milliliter (c/mL)

-Water visibility is greater than 4 feet (on Sept 7, 2022, ~62 inches (bottom)).

The Town Beach water quality monitoring sign (the Dial sign) stays at Green - all activities allowed.

What happens next:

The Board of Health will discuss in our next meeting if we will do one more water quality test this season.
